Creative Orgasm Results in Conceptual Folly

motorola_xoom_airplane.jpg

Sometimes a group of creatives will sit around and come up with an idea that’s really cool and would be a lot of fun to shoot. Sadly, these ideas usually have nothing to do with selling a product. For example, what does taking a tablet PC on a motorbike, a motorboat and the sing of a plane have anything at all to do with how well the tablet will perform in normal circumstances?

None, whatsoever.

Which is why this new work for The Carphone Warehouse which hypes the Motorola XOOM 3G with WIFI is pure folly. A bunch of creatives getting their rocks off with complete disregard for the client’s budget. Of course, being able to tweet from the wings of an airplane is important to some people, we’re sure.
